I think it is easier for patients to post their updated pics month to month or every three months. We can take so many more pics at home than at the clinic.

 

Clinics have a tougher time getting patients back in for updated photos, especially since most of us are from out of town. But those clinics that are good at taking pics can show just as much as what us patients show...

The real question is the lighting conditions. Clinics can post pictures with flattering lighting directions, and patients can do the same. They both give the illusion of density.

 

The definitive benchmarking is the amount of FU/cm2.

Personally, I think it's a huge help to prospective patients to see a wider variety of clinics sharing examples of their work.

 

However, in my opinion, there is nothing like following a patient's progress from beginning to end who doesn't know what to expect. Whereas clinics usually select examples of their best work to put their best foot forward online (and who can blame them), nothing is better than following patients and their entire journey documented with photos to get the least biased feedback on what a clinic typically produces.

 

Therefore, I feel it's optimal to look through cilnic and patient posted photos, and if possible, meet patients in person.
